[问题] Ubuntu安装软件的两种方式?

楼主: dharma (達)   2018-01-24 14:10:33
Ubuntu安装软件,大致有两种方式
请问这两种使用后会有什么差别?
例如不同的安装方式
会有不同的更新方式(手动、自动)
或是会否出现在软件已安装列表的差异..
thanks
以Ubuntu安装JDK为例
方法一:
安装oracle Java JDK 首先,安装依赖包
$ sudo apt-get install python-software-properties
添加仓库源:
$ sudo add-apt-repository ppa:webupd8team/java
更新软件包列表
$ sudo apt-get update
安装java JDK:
$ sudo apt-get install oracle-java8-installer
http://topspeedsnail.com/ubuntu16-install-java-jdk/
方法二:
1.官网下载 JDK文件:jdk-8u121-linux-x64.tar.gz
2.创建一个目录作为JDK的安装目录,我的目录为 /opt/java
sudo mkdir /opt/java
3.移动文件到/opt/java目录下
sudo mv jdk-8u121-linux-x64.tar.gz /opt/java
4.解压文件
tar -zxvf jdk-8u121-linux-x64.tar.gz
http://blog.csdn.net/bluish_white/article/details/56509446
作者: hijkxyzuw (i,j,k) ×(x,y,z)   2018-01-24 14:22:00
法一可以用 apt remove 移除,而且 apt 会知道你有装法二你要自己记得装了什么,装时改了什么,怎么移除
作者: oniondada (Onion)   2018-01-24 16:24:00
推荐用套件管理程式比较好管理
作者: Bellkna (柔弱气质伪少女)   2018-01-24 19:57:00
法2是用在distro没提供你要的版本时使用比较好
作者: qoopichu (非洲边缘鲁蛇)   2018-01-26 02:35:00
你开套件库看看不就知道了?
作者: chuegou (chuegou)   2018-01-26 08:44:00
怎么没有第三种git clone自己编译
作者: Bencrie   2018-01-26 09:05:00
oracle jdk 没 source code 啊
作者: Bellkna (柔弱气质伪少女)   2018-01-26 09:07:00
通常用distro提供的版本应该没什么问题只不过有些旧程式只吃旧版时就得用法2自己来了git clone应该也算法2 属于下载后自行编译
作者: qoopichu (非洲边缘鲁蛇)   2018-01-26 15:32:00
Ubuntu软件中心或是Synaptic
作者: fishlinghu (令狐瑜)   2018-01-27 20:20:00
第2种方法感觉很雷啊 很难整理= =
作者: Bellkna (柔弱气质伪少女)   2018-01-28 05:23:00
第2种是真的很雷 可是遇到只吃特殊版本的也只能这样

Links booklink

Contact Us: admin [ a t ] ucptt.com